1. What Is a 4-Inch Galvanized Pipe?
The term "4-inch" refers to the nominal inner diameter of the pipe, while Schedule 40 represents the wall thickness, which is considered standard in general-use piping. These pipes are made from carbon steel and then hot-dip galvanized, a process in which the pipe is coated in molten zinc to prevent rust and corrosion.
This type of pipe is known for:
Exceptional resistance to weather and chemicals
High tensile and yield strength
Suitability for both above-ground and underground applications
2. Technical Specifications
According to standard pipe dimension charts:
Outer Diameter (OD): 4.500 inches (114.3 mm)
Wall Thickness: 0.237 inches (6.02 mm)
Weight per Foot: Approx. 10.79 lbs (16.06 kg/m)
Length: Typically available in 21-foot sections (custom cuts also possible)
These dimensions make it ideal for transporting moderate volumes of liquid or gas while retaining sufficient strength for load-bearing tasks.
3. Manufacturing Standards
The 4-inch galvanized pipe typically meets or exceeds the following industrial standards:
ASTM A53 Grade B
ASTM A123 for Zinc Coating
ASME B36.10M for Welded Steel Pipe Dimensions
Each pipe undergoes pressure testing and galvanization to ensure long-lasting protection and mechanical reliability.
4. Advantages of Galvanized Steel Pipe
1. Corrosion Resistance
The zinc coating provides a sacrificial barrier, protecting the underlying steel from environmental damage like rust, acid rain, and moisture.
2. Extended Lifespan
Galvanized pipes can last up to 40-50 years in average conditions, and even longer in dry indoor environments.
3. Strong and Durable
Carbon steel provides mechanical strength while the Schedule 40 thickness ensures it can handle moderate pressures without deformation.
4. Low Maintenance
Compared to PVC or untreated steel, galvanized pipes require minimal maintenance over time.
5. Economical
They offer a cost-effective solution compared to stainless steel or alloy piping while still providing significant longevity.
5. Common Applications
4-inch galvanized pipes are used in a wide variety of industries:
• Residential Plumbing
Used for water supply lines, drainage, and venting in older buildings or in areas that still permit galvanized plumbing.
• Fencing and Railings
Ideal for outdoor fence posts, handrails, guardrails, and gates, especially in coastal or rainy regions.
• Construction and Framing
Used in temporary structures, scaffoldings, and pipe racks due to their load-bearing strength.
• Irrigation Systems
Used in agriculture to support water transport systems and sprinkler lines.
• Industrial Piping
Handles compressed air, steam, and gases in commercial facilities.
• Sign Posts and Bollards
Provides a sturdy and corrosion-resistant option for traffic signage, parking lot posts, and safety bollards.
6. End Types and Configurations
Pipes are available in different end finishes:
Threaded Ends: Allow for easy assembly using couplings or fittings
Plain Ends: Suitable for welding or flange connection
Beveled Ends: Common for industrial welding applications

8. Design & Installation Tips
When installing 4-inch galvanized pipe:
Support Spacing: Use pipe hangers or clamps every 10–12 feet horizontally
Thread Sealant: Always use Teflon tape or pipe dope for leak-proof connections
Avoid Mixing with Copper: Can lead to galvanic corrosion if water is shared between dissimilar metals
Inspections: Especially in saltwater or industrial environments, inspect regularly for coating wear or damage
9. Safety and Handling
Galvanized pipes are heavy and should be handled with care. Use gloves to avoid cuts from sharp threading, and follow proper lifting protocols. If welding, be cautious—burning galvanized steel can release harmful zinc fumes, so adequate ventilation is essential.
